True. And actually you could play with this tuba while you were in the sauna. One of our top composers in Finland, Atso Almila, made a piece especially for this "tubasauna". This tuba is St. Petersburg tuba and is now located in saunamuseum Finland. Harri also arranged this tuba throwing competition.dwaskew wrote:just for the record, the tubist with the mouthpiece is Harri Lidsle. He is a very active and popular tuba player in Finland. Harri also served as our ITEC host in 2001. The tuba sauna was located outside Sibelius Hall and was kind of a funny tribute to life in Finland.
